Muja Muhammad
Caption: Muja Muhammad
Actor Source: IMDB Muja Muhammad is an actor, known for Black Boots (2013), Scott Free (2013) and My Brother's Keeper: A Drama Series (2006).
Ava Allan pictures →
Felicity Mason pictures →
Kristen Miller pictures →